WBJEE · Chemistry · Structure of Atom

Which hydrogen like species will have the same radius as that of \(1^{\text {st }}\) Bohr orbit of hydrogen atom?

  1. A \(\mathrm{n}=2, \mathrm{Li}^{2+}\)
  2. B \(\mathrm{n}=2, \mathrm{Be}^{3+}\)
  3. C \(\mathrm{n}=2, \mathrm{He}^{+}\)
  4. D \(\mathrm{n}=3, \mathrm{Li}^{2+}\)

Correct Answer

(B) \(\mathrm{n}=2, \mathrm{Be}^{3+}\)

Hint : Radius of \(n^{\text {th }}\) orbit \(=0.529 \frac{n^2}{Z} Ã…\) Radius of \(1^{\text {st }}\) Bohr Orbit of Hydrogen atom \(=0.529 \times \frac{1^2}{1}=0.529 Ã…\) Radius of \(2^{\text {nd }}\) Bohr Orbit of \(\mathrm{Be}^{3+}=0.529 \frac{2^2}{4}=0.529 Ã…\)
